The ingredients needed to make Vegan kimchi:
- Get 1 large Napa Cabbage
- Take Diacon radish
- Take 1 bunch green onion
- Take 1 whole garlic bulb
- Make ready 2 tbs sea salt
- Get Korean red chili flake gogogun or paste
- Take 2 tbs sugar
- Make ready 2 tbs corn starch (make a slurry)

Steps to make Vegan kimchi:
- Take cabbage and take a part and fill sink with cold water emerge cabbage. In a huge bowl drain cabbage. Put sea salt all over cabbage mix and lightly push on the leafs (so you hear the membrane breaks) set aside with a towel over top for 4 hours
- Rinse cabbage drain chop in 1 inch pieces same with diacon radish
- Mix in another bowl the Korean chili flake, (put on gloves this chili will burn and stain)garlic green onion, corn starch. Mix in red chili mixture together. (it should be red smells spicy and garlicky you can put less or more of the chili mixture) up to your taste.
- Put this in containers with lids that snap like Tupperware or Mason jar. Let set in refrigerator for a week or eat that day.
Kimchi is a staple in Korean cooking. It's essentially fermented vegetables, most commonly cabbage, carrot and radish, which are mixed with a spicy paste. Traditionally made using shrimp or fish paste, we instead use soy sauce and nori for a similar salty taste of the sea. You can buy Kimchi at the store but be sure to check the ingredients as most kimchi is NOT vegan!
